| Five Essentials Of 2011
2011 has been a year full of amazing releases! Because of this making a top list this year is quite hard. Instead, I present to you a list to five essential albums that came out last year that I highly recommend! | 5 | | Owen Ghost Town
With intricate guitar riffs, moody atmosphere, and mellow melodies Owen's Ghost Town is an incredible album from start to finish. | 4 | | Empire! Empire! (I Was a Lonely Estate) Home After Three Months Away
Home After Three Months Away is incredibly melodic and succinct as compared to their previous full length. Not only this, but it still has the compelling emotional impact of an epic due to Empire Empire's intricate lyrics, vocal delivery, and musical capabilities. | 3 | | La Dispute Wildlife
Feeling more like a full length Here, Hear album, Wildlife is one of La Dispute's most focused release. Best part of the album is the lyrics and vocal delivery. Very unique and amazing overall. | 2 | | Trophy Scars Never Born, Never Dead
Pretty much one of the most epic releases last year. Not much more else can be said about this that already has not been said. | 1 | | Dir en grey DUM SPIRO SPERO
One of the best international releases I've heard come out last year. Dir En Grey crafted pretty much their most aggressive and heavy record which gives their American counter-parts a run for their money. Not only is this album heavy but it does share its softer and more melody driven songs. | |
